2. Tracking Ovulation

One of the keys to successful conception is knowing when you’re ovulating. Ovulation is the process of releasing an egg from the ovary, and it typically occurs once a month. By tracking your ovulation, you can determine the best time to try for a baby. There are various methods for tracking ovulation, including using an ovulation predictor kit, tracking your basal body temperature, and monitoring your cervical mucus. These methods are relatively inexpensive and can greatly increase your chances of conceiving naturally.

3. Home Insemination Kits

For couples facing male infertility, or for same-sex couples, home insemination kits can be a cost-effective solution. These kits include a syringe, a collection cup, and possibly a cervical cap to help the sperm reach the cervix. The process is similar to artificial insemination, but can be done in the comfort and privacy of your own home. However, it’s important to note that home insemination may not be as effective as other fertility treatments and should be discussed with a doctor beforehand.
